Lake Balaton 2026 Swim & Festival Updates

Entities: HungaroMet Observatory · Balatonboglár · Balaton regional organizers · Szamárfül Family Festival · Balaton

Overview

In early July 2026 Hungarian authorities announced a new lake waterway for the 44th Lidl Balaton swim. By late July a detailed programme was released, featuring the V. Kenese ArtFeszt arts festival (July 29‑August 2) and the 5.2 km open‑water swim across Lake Balaton scheduled for 1 August, with registration open until the eve and options for a 2.6 km half‑distance and a stand‑up‑paddle‑board crossing. Boat services on the Balatonboglár–Révfülöp route were adjusted, with some evening cruises cancelled to accommodate the race. A broader schedule of concerts, street‑music festivals, jazz events, wine weeks and family‑friendly activities filled the lake’s surroundings through early August, culminating in the Szamárfül Family Festival in Pécs at month’s end.

On 31 July the organisers confirmed that the 44th Balaton‑átúszás would go ahead on 1 August after two weather‑related postponements. Nearly 11 000 participants from 60 countries, representing 1 190 Hungarian towns, entered the race. Swimmers chose between the classic 5.2 km swim, a 2.6 km half‑distance, or a 5.2 km SUP crossing. The start at 07:00 h was met with extreme heat (air 26‑36 °C, water ~25 °C). Safety was provided by 150 sailboats, three hospital ships, rescue motor‑boats, 60 kayakers and more than a thousand volunteers.

The men's winner, Nagy Nándor, finished in 59 min 20 s, marking the 250,000th finisher in the event’s history. Regular ferry services on the Balatonboglár–Révfülöp line were temporarily altered, with several passenger and sunset cruises cancelled for the day to support the race.
